Bunny Oreo Balls are a delightful no-bake treat that combines the rich flavors of crushed Oreos and creamy cream cheese, all coated in smooth white chocolate. These irresistible bite-sized gems are perfect for Easter celebrations or any festive gathering. Easy to make and fully customizable, Bunny Oreo Balls can be decorated to fit any occasion, making them a fun treat that brings joy and nostalgia with every bite.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 36 Oreos (crushed)
  • 8 oz cream cheese (softened)
  • 12 oz white chocolate melts
  • 1 cup confectioners’ sugar
  • 1/2 cup pastel sprinkles

Instructions

  1. Crush the Oreos in a zip-top bag until they resemble fine crumbs.
  2. In a large bowl, mix the crushed Oreos with softened cream cheese until well combined.
  3. Scoop out tablespoon-sized portions and roll them into balls. Place on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
  4. Melt the white chocolate in a microwave-safe bowl until smooth.
  5. Dip each ball into the melted chocolate, allowing excess to drip off before placing back on parchment.
  6. While wet, sprinkle with pastel sprinkles. Refrigerate for about an hour until firm.
